Alibaba reportedly offered $1.5 billion to acquire Chinese grocery delivery firm Pupu, more than double Sun Art Retail’s earlier $600 million bid. The deal appears aimed at strengthening Alibaba’s frequency-driven grocery, logistics, and consumer habit ecosystem rather than a simple asset purchase. The report is constructive for Alibaba’s retail and delivery strategy, but remains speculative pending confirmation.
